The Influence of Cognitive Bias
Our minds are influenced by biases that dramatically affect our decision-making, especially in high-stakes situations like sports betting. Take, for example, the “availability heuristic,” a cognitive bias that leads us to overestimate our chances of winning based on recent successes or memorable outcomes. Perhaps you remember a time when an underdog bet paid off, and suddenly that wild gamble starts to seem like a stroke of genius.

The Temptation of Control
Another intriguing psychological aspect at play is our innate desire for control. In an unpredictable world, betting may provide a false sense of mastery over outcomes.
